Informatics Practices Class 11: Unit -3 MCQs

 Unit 3: Database concepts and the Structured Query Language 

Database Concepts: Introduction to database concepts and its need, Database Management System.

Relational data model: Concept of domain, tuple, relation, candidate key, primary key, alternate key

Advantages of using Structured Query Language, Data Definition Language, Data Query Language and Data Manipulation Language, Introduction to MySQL, creating a database using MySQL, Data Types

Data Definition: CREATE DATABASE, CREATE TABLE, DROP, ALTER

Data Query: SELECT, FROM, WHERE with relational operators, BETWEEN, logical 

operators, IS NULL, IS NOT NULL

Data Manipulation: INSERT, DELETE, UPDATE

[24/07, 7:04 PM] Meta AI: Here are some MCQs on the topic "Database Concepts" with explanations:


MCQ 1:

What is the primary purpose of a database management system (DBMS)?


A) To store data

B) To manage data

C) To secure data

D) To recover data


Answer: B) To manage data


Explanation: A DBMS is a software system that manages and controls access to a database, allowing users to perform various operations like creating, updating, and querying data.


MCQ 2:

Which type of database uses tables to store data?


A) Hierarchical database

B) Network database

C) Relational database

D) Object-oriented database


Answer: C) Relational database


Explanation: Relational databases use tables (also known as relations) to store data, with well-defined relationships between tables.


MCQ 3:

What is data normalization?


A) The process of dividing large tables into smaller tables

B) The process of combining small tables into larger tables

C) The process of securing data

D) The process of recovering data


Answer: A) The process of dividing large tables into smaller tables


Explanation: Data normalization is the process of organizing data to minimize data redundancy and improve data integrity, involving dividing large tables into smaller tables with well-defined relationships.


MCQ 4:

What is the main advantage of using a relational database?


A) Improved data security

B) Improved data integrity

C) Improved data scalability

D) All of the above


Answer: D) All of the above


Explanation: Relational databases offer improved data security, integrity, and scalability due to their structured and organized approach to storing data.


Let me know if you'd like me to generate more MCQs!

[24/07, 7:11 PM] Meta AI: Here are some more MCQs on the topic "Database Concepts" with explanations:


MCQ 5:

What is the purpose of a primary key in a relational database?


A) To uniquely identify each record

B) To establish relationships between tables

C) To index data for faster retrieval

D) To secure data from unauthorized access


Answer: A) To uniquely identify each record


Explanation: A primary key is a unique identifier for each record in a table, ensuring that no two records have the same primary key value.


MCQ 6:

Which of the following is a characteristic of a hierarchical database?


A) Data is stored in tables

B) Data is stored in a tree-like structure

C) Data is stored in a graph-like structure

D) Data is stored in an object-oriented structure


Answer: B) Data is stored in a tree-like structure


Explanation: Hierarchical databases store data in a tree-like structure, with a single parent-child relationship between data elements.


MCQ 7:

What is data denormalization?


A) The process of normalizing data

B) The process of denormalizing data

C) The process of optimizing data for faster retrieval

D) The process of securing data from unauthorized access


Answer: C) The process of optimizing data for faster retrieval


Explanation: Data denormalization involves intentionally de-normalizing data to improve query performance, often by duplicating data or combining tables.


MCQ 8:

Which of the following is a benefit of using a database management system (DBMS)?


A) Improved data security

B) Improved data integrity

C) Improved data scalability

D) All of the above


Answer: D) All of the above


Explanation: A DBMS offers improved data security, integrity, and scalability, as well as support for multiple users and applications.


Let me know if you'd like me to generate more MCQs!

[24/07, 7:12 PM] Meta AI: Here are some more MCQs on the topic "Database Concepts" with explanations:


MCQ 9:

What is the purpose of an index in a database?


A) To uniquely identify each record

B) To establish relationships between tables

C) To speed up data retrieval

D) To secure data from unauthorized access


Answer: C) To speed up data retrieval


Explanation: An index is a data structure that improves query performance by allowing the database to quickly locate specific data.


MCQ 10:

Which of the following is a type of database constraint?


A) Primary key

B) Foreign key

C) Unique constraint

D) All of the above


Answer: D) All of the above


Explanation: Database constraints include primary keys, foreign keys, unique constraints, and check constraints, which help maintain data consistency and accuracy.


MCQ 11:

What is the purpose of a view in a database?


A) To create a new table

B) To modify an existing table

C) To provide a virtual table based on a query

D) To secure data from unauthorized access


Answer: C) To provide a virtual table based on a query


Explanation: A view is a virtual table based on a query, allowing users to access data without modifying the underlying tables.


MCQ 12:

Which of the following is a benefit of data normalization?


A) Improved data security

B) Improved data integrity

C) Reduced data redundancy

D) All of the above


Answer: D) All of the above


Explanation: Data normalization improves data security, integrity, and scalability, while reducing data redundancy and improving data consistency.


Let me know if you'd like me to generate more MCQs!

[24/07, 7:12 PM] Meta AI: Here are some more MCQs on the topic "Database Concepts" with explanations:


MCQ 13:

What is the purpose of a transaction in a database?


A) To execute a single query

B) To execute multiple queries as a single unit

C) To secure data from unauthorized access

D) To improve data retrieval performance


Answer: B) To execute multiple queries as a single unit


Explanation: A transaction is a sequence of operations performed as a single, all-or-nothing unit, ensuring data consistency and integrity.


MCQ 14:

Which of the following is a type of database join?


A) Inner join

B) Outer join

C) Left join

D) All of the above


Answer: D) All of the above


Explanation: Database joins include inner joins, outer joins, left joins, right joins, and full outer joins, which combine data from multiple tables.


MCQ 15:

What is the purpose of a stored procedure in a database?


A) To execute a single query

B) To execute multiple queries as a single unit

C) To encapsulate complex logic and reuse code

D) To secure data from unauthorized access


Answer: C) To encapsulate complex logic and reuse code


Explanation: A stored procedure is a precompiled SQL program that encapsulates complex logic and can be reused, improving performance and maintainability.


MCQ 16:

Which of the following is a benefit of using a database?


A) Improved data security

B) Improved data integrity

C) Improved data scalability

D) All of the above


Answer: D) All of the above


Explanation: Using a database provides improved data security, integrity, and scalability, as well as support for multiple users and applications.


Let me know if you'd like me to generate more MCQs!

NEXT

Comments

Popular posts from this blog

Class 11th Informatics Practices Notes: Exam Preparation Made Easy Unit-3

Informatics Practices Class 11: Unit -4 MCQs Part-1

Class 11th Informatics Practices Notes: Exam Preparation Made Easy Unit-2